What part of speech is hypothesizes?

Hypothesizes can be categorized as a verb.

What does hypothesizes mean?

Definitions

Verb

hypothesize - to believe especially on uncertain or tentative grounds; "Scientists supposed that large dinosaurs lived in swamps"
